No card, layout or canvas for me to share with you today as I seem to have spent all week "helping" my 9 year old son with his homework....making a poster of a habitat - in this case a woodland habitat.

I am going to share this project with you though as "we" used so many stamps on it LOL!! We made it by joining 4 sheets of plain white 12" x 12" cardstock together and then used chalks to make a coloured background before drawing on the trees and colouring them.




 The leaves were all stamped using the leafy stamp from  Unity's Naturally You kit available here and another leaf stamp.

We stamped the fungi from Unity's Naturally You kit  straight on to the poster and coloured them with Marvy markers. The snail from the same kit was stamped on to shrink plastic and coloured with chalks before heating.



We also used the bracken stamp from Unity's Moments in Bloom kit available here to stamp in clumps at the base of the trees and Unity's Insightful Meadows set to stamp in the left foreground.
